Abstract
A sealed lead-acid storage battery of the Invention comprises a containers accommodating a lead dioxide cathode, a lead anode and an additional gas absorbing electrode formed from a mixture composed of an electrically conductive carbonaceous material and of a slightly water soluble quinoid compound having a low oxidation-reduction potential.
